Meizu M6 Note vs OnePlus 7T Pro
Here you can compare Meizu M6 Note and OnePlus 7T Pro. Comparing Meizu M6 Note vs OnePlus 7T Pro on Smartprix enables you to check their respective specs scores and unique features. It would potentially help you understand how Meizu M6 Note stands against OnePlus 7T Pro and which one should you buy The current lowest price found for Meizu M6 Note is ₹8,531 and for OnePlus 7T Pro is ₹32,999. The details of both of these products were last updated on Apr 05, 2024.
Specification | Meizu M6 Note | OnePlus 7T Pro |
---|---|---|
Display | 5.5 inches, 1080 x 1920 pixels | 6.67 inches, 1440 x 3120 pixels |
Rear Camera | 12 MP + 5 MP with autofocus | 48 MP f/1.6 (Wide Angle) 8 MP f/2.4 (Telephoto) 16 MP f/2.2 (Ultra Wide) with autofocus |
Internal Memory | 32 GB | 256 GB |
Battery | 4000 mAh, Li-ion Battery | 4085 mAh, Li-Po Battery |
OS | Android v7.1.2 (Nougat) | Android v10.0 |
Price | ₹8,531 | ₹32,999 |
